Transaction 77c4e173c3650201b5538ac882751bb6617a754a349d598e9e42f8fedbb35f46
1 Input
2 Outputs
- 77c4e173c3650201b5538ac882751bb6617a754a349d598e9e42f8fedbb35f46:0
- 77c4e173c3650201b5538ac882751bb6617a754a349d598e9e42f8fedbb35f46:1
value 3434478
address 1ArG3JwEbF4WrCiEnXQXUAgQumAVzqnQHD
value 17401270
address 3BcC7ZpLiMVyWZewc92wH9gNrjErZJEgU9